Output dbfc20af3e63aecbd52fe2e6f43d36f446ff18f1604f22cf04506569dc266c4a:1

value
8602
script pubkey
OP_0 OP_PUSHBYTES_20 c680644a0d0536946463e3cb789926dc2375dd8d
address
bc1qc6qxgjsdq5mfgerru09h3xfxms3hthvdg03hun
transaction
dbfc20af3e63aecbd52fe2e6f43d36f446ff18f1604f22cf04506569dc266c4a
spent
true